Background
The existing commodity packaging is carried out on a conveyor belt, which is called a packaging production line, in the actual commodity packaging process, the condition that no commodity is filled in a packaging box occurs, defective products are generated, and therefore the defective products on the packaging production line need to be removed, so that the commodity packaging can be measured and screened by a weighing device during conveying, and the defective product removing work is completed.
The existing dynamic weighing device for the packaging production line has the problems of low efficiency in small piece weighing application, inaccurate large piece weighing application, good general compatibility of large and small pieces and easy influence on detection caused by the fact that more articles are moved to a detection position.

Detailed Description
The present invention will be further explained with reference to the accompanying drawings:
as shown in fig. 1-4: the utility model provides a dynamic weighing device, includes dynamic weighing subassembly, the subassembly of getting in stock and supporting component, the subassembly of getting in stock, dynamic weighing subassembly and the subassembly of getting in stock connect gradually, and the bottom of the subassembly of getting in stock, dynamic weighing subassembly and the subassembly of getting in stock all is provided with supporting component.
As shown in fig. 1-4, the dynamic weighing assembly comprises a first dynamic weighing assembly 1 and a second dynamic weighing assembly 2, which are connected in sequence and then respectively connected with a loading assembly 3 and a unloading assembly 4.
As shown in fig. 1-4, each of the first dynamic weighing assembly 3 and the second dynamic weighing assembly 4 includes a transmission wheel 7, a transmission belt 8, a transmission wheel seat 13 and a pressure sensing assembly, the transmission wheel 7 is respectively mounted at two ends of the transmission belt 8 and then placed on the transmission wheel seat 13, and the pressure sensing assembly is arranged at the bottom of the transmission wheel seat 13 and connected with the transmission wheel seat through a support rod 6.
As shown in fig. 4, the pressure sensing assembly includes a pressure sensor 5 and a pressure sensor fixing box 9, and the pressure sensor 5 includes four corners respectively disposed in the pressure sensor fixing box 9, and is connected to the transmission wheel seat 13 through a support rod 6.
As shown in fig. 3, the supporting assembly comprises a supporting leg 11, a supporting foot 10 and an adjusting bolt 12, wherein the supporting foot 10 is installed in the supporting leg 11, and the adjusting bolt 12 is arranged on the supporting leg 11 and used for adjusting the distance between the supporting leg 11 and the supporting foot 10, so as to adjust the balance of the dynamic weighing device.
As shown in fig. 2, each of the loading assembly and the unloading assembly includes a transmission wheel 7 and a transmission belt 8, and the transmission wheels 7 are respectively installed at two ends of the transmission belt 8.
To sum up, the utility model increases the structure stability performance by adopting four pressure sensors distributed at four angular positions in each set of weighing section, and adopts two weighing sections, when weighing small pieces, one dynamic weighing section belt conveyor is used for weighing, and when weighing large pieces, the two dynamic weighing section belt conveyors are combined together for weighing; the utility model has the advantages of simple structure, low cost and long service life.
